Many people ask whether online therapy can truly help. For common concerns such as stress, anxiety, depression, relationship difficulties, or navigating life transitions, online therapy has been shown to be as effective as traditional in-person sessions.
One of the main benefits is flexibility - clients can choose the format that fits their life, whether that is video calls, phone sessions, live chat, or in-app messaging. This flexibility makes it easier to schedule care without disrupting daily routines.
Therapists who provide online services are licensed professionals, and clients may change therapists at any time if they want a different fit. For many people, remote therapy provides a practical, effective way to address everyday mental health concerns while fitting care into a busy life.
